Nutritional Information of Banana Bread With Chocolate Chips

Nutritional Chart Of Banana Bread With Chocolate Chips

A slice of banana bread with chocolate chips contains approximately 196 calories. The number of calories can vary depending on the recipe and the size of the slice.

In addition to calories, banana bread with chocolate chips also contains a variety of nutrients, including carbohydrates, protein, and fat. Here's a breakdown of the nutritional information per slice:

  • Carbohydrates: 29.3g
  • Protein: 3.1g
  • Fat: 8g
  • Fiber: 1.5g
  • Sugar: 14g

As you can see, banana bread with chocolate chips is high in carbohydrates and sugar. However, it also contains a good amount of fiber, which can help regulate blood sugar levels and keep you feeling full for longer.

How to Make Healthier Banana Bread With Chocolate Chips

Healthy Banana Bread With Chocolate Chips

If you're looking for a healthier option, there are a few changes you can make to the recipe. Here are some tips to make your banana bread with chocolate chips healthier:

  • Use whole wheat flour instead of all-purpose flour. Whole wheat flour is higher in fiber and nutrients than all-purpose flour.
  • Use coconut oil or unsweetened applesauce instead of butter. These options are lower in saturated fat and calories than butter.
  • Use dark chocolate chips instead of milk chocolate chips. Dark chocolate is higher in antioxidants and lower in sugar than milk chocolate.
  • Use honey or maple syrup instead of white sugar. These natural sweeteners are lower in calories and have a lower glycemic index than white sugar.

By making these changes, you can reduce the number of calories in your banana bread with chocolate chips and make it a healthier option.
